Senior Systems/ Infrastructure Engineer

Amentum · McLean, VA · 2 wk ago
On-siteInformation TechnologyFull-time

We are seeking a highly experienced Senior Systems/Infrastructure Engineer with advanced technical expertise supporting complex enterprise environments to join our team in McLean, VA. This role supports critical efforts for a premier government contractor, where we deliver trailblazing solutions with unwavering integrity, inclusion, and collaboration.

About the Role

The ideal candidate will have advanced systems engineering experience in a Microsoft-based infrastructure, with expertise in Microsoft SQL Server, Microsoft Exchange, Active Directory, enterprise backup solutions, and Cisco networking. This senior-level position involves designing, implementing, maintaining, securing, documenting, and troubleshooting mission-critical systems in a highly regulated enterprise or government environment.

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, maintain, and support enterprise Microsoft infrastructure.
  • Administer and troubleshoot Active Directory, Exchange, SQL Server, backup platforms, and Cisco network infrastructure.
  • Create secure system baseline configurations and maintain compliance through technical assessments, auditing, and continuous monitoring.
  • Generate documentation of processes and system artifacts for internal and customer review.
  • Manage enterprise patching, system maintenance, vulnerability remediation (POA&Ms), and risk reduction efforts.
  • Support disaster recovery and business continuity planning through backups and restores.
  • Mentor junior administrators and engineers, serving as a senior technical escalation resource for complex infrastructure problems.
  • Coordinate with cybersecurity, networking, database, server, and management teams to ensure infrastructure remains secure, available, properly documented, and compliant.

Skills

  • Microsoft Infrastructure Engineering: Advanced experience with engineering, administering, securing, and troubleshooting Microsoft enterprise environments (Windows 10/11, Server 2019/2022, Exchange, MS SQL) in both physical and virtualized environments. Ability to design, maintain, and support secure Microsoft environments using Group Policy Management, WSUS deployment, scripting, and automation to hardened STIGs for compliance.
  • Active Directory: Expert-level knowledge of Active Directory Domain Services, including forest and domain architecture, Domain Controllers, OU and GPOs, DNS integration, AD replication, backup and recovery, trust relationships, and PKI/certificate services. Ability to troubleshoot complex replication, authentication, permission, GPO, and domain controller issues.
  • Microsoft Exchange: Advanced experience engineering, administering, maintaining, and supporting Microsoft Exchange 2019, including securing, patching, backup/recovery, and troubleshooting complex messaging, database health, mail flow, and service outages.
  • Microsoft SQL Server: High-level SQL Server administration and engineering experience in Microsoft SQL Server 2019/2022, including installation, configuration (security compliance and access permissions), maintenance, optimization, tuning, report generation, monitoring, backups, restores, and troubleshooting performance and connectivity issues.
  • Enterprise Backup and Recovery: Advanced experience with enterprise backup and disaster recovery solutions, including design, configuration, scheduling, validation, and restore/recovery for physical and virtual machines and applications (Exchange, SQL). Ability to ensure critical systems are properly backed up, recoverable, and tested.
  • Cisco Networking and General Networking: High-level networking experience with strong Cisco administration skills, including network segmentation, VLANs, VPN, ACLs, routing/switching, port security, and firewalls. Ability to troubleshoot network connectivity, routing, switching, DNS, DHCP, segmentation, and performance issues.
  • Experience with virtualization (e.g., Hyper-V, VMware), security hardening (e.g., NIST 800-53, RMF, STIGs), patch management (e.g., WSUS, SCCM), vulnerability management (e.g., Rapid7, Nessus, POA&M), compliance reporting, auditing, and documentation (e.g., SOP, SSP, change control).
